Renamed `WATCHDOG_RESTART_KEY` to `KG_WATCHDOG_HEARTBEAT_TOKEN` to align with the Brindlewood naming convention adopted across all Vexner Retail kiosk services. The old name is still read as a fallback but logs a deprecation warning on every boot; plan to remove the fallback in v3.0. Update any provisioning scripts that template the kiosk environment file, and verify the watchdog reports a clean heartbeat after rotation. In your `.env` on each kiosk, the renamed variable should appear exactly as follows:

sealed setting: RELAY_SECRET5=82864

## Migration Step 4: Update the Assignment Heuristic Settings

Before switching RouteWeaver to the new driver-assignment heuristic, confirm that all pending dispatch jobs in the Calder region have drained. Support staff should verify this in the dispatch console, then apply the updated weighting parameters exactly as specified—any deviation can cause drivers to be double-assigned during the transition window. Once the queue shows zero pending jobs, apply the following configuration values to the assignment service.

deployment values, yadug-bawif:
[framir]
team = pelox
access_code = ac_a38ab2
owner = tamion.julael
host = framir.tolvaqlabs.test
port = 11211
peer = tammir.zemvargrid.local
salt = 2215ef03
pin = 1541

Before sealing the signing keys for the Glintwork platform, confirm that the Kestrel (iOS-style) and Moorhen (Android-style) client SDKs expose identical cryptographic surfaces: same key-wrap format, same attestation payload fields, same error codes for expired material. New team members should run the parity harness twice and have a second witness initial the printout. Once both witnesses agree, the ceremony lead unlocks the escrow ledger, which requires the recovery passphrase recorded immediately below.

vault phrase of bagef-bagep = oliix-holdor

# Autocomplete index latency — notes for eng sync
# Glimmerbox suggest queries p95 at 900ms since Tuesday.
# Cause: index shards rebalanced onto the cold tier after the
# Havenreach migration. Mitigation: pinned shards to warm nodes;
# permanent fix tracked separately. Reindex job needs the new
# warm-tier credential to run. The line below must be present
# in this file:

sealed setting: LEDGER_TOKEN13=5d842615a26d7